How Modern Encryption Protects Your Digital Life
The Invisible Shield
Every day, encryption protocols silently protect trillions of digital transactions, communications, and data transfers. This mathematical armor has evolved from simple substitution ciphers to sophisticated algorithms that would take even supercomputers billions of years to crack. Modern encryption leverages advanced number theory and computational complexity to create security that’s transparent to users but impenetrable to attackers.
Core Encryption Technologies
1. Symmetric Key Encryption
Algorithms like AES-256 use a single shared key for both encryption and decryption, providing exceptional speed for bulk data protection. The Advanced Encryption Standard (AES) underwent rigorous evaluation by the U.S. government before being selected in 2001. Its 256-bit variant has 2^256 possible keys – more than atoms in the observable universe. Financial institutions and governments worldwide rely on AES for securing sensitive data, with proper implementations remaining resistant to all known attacks.
2. Public Key Cryptography
RSA and elliptic curve cryptography (ECC) solve the key distribution problem by using mathematically linked key pairs. A message encrypted with a public key can only be decrypted by the corresponding private key. Modern systems typically use 2048-bit RSA or 256-bit ECC keys, with the latter providing equivalent security with smaller key sizes. These asymmetric systems enable secure key exchange and digital signatures that authenticate message senders. The transition to post-quantum cryptography standards is underway to protect against future quantum computer attacks.
3. Hash Functions
Cryptographic hashes like SHA-256 create unique digital fingerprints for data verification. These one-way functions produce fixed-length outputs regardless of input size, making them ideal for password storage and data integrity checks. Modern systems use SHA-3 or BLAKE3 for new implementations, as these resist length-extension attacks that affected earlier algorithms. Properly salted password hashes ensure that even database breaches don’t immediately compromise user credentials.
Everyday Encryption Applications
HTTPS and TLS
The Transport Layer Security protocol combines symmetric and asymmetric encryption to secure web traffic. Modern TLS 1.3 establishes connections faster while eliminating obsolete cipher suites, with forward secrecy ensuring past communications remain secure even if long-term keys are compromised.
End-to-End Messaging
Signal Protocol and its derivatives use perfect forward secrecy and deniable authentication to protect billions of daily messages. These systems generate temporary keys for each message and provide cryptographic proofs of message integrity without revealing sender identity.
Emerging Cryptographic Challenges
The encryption landscape faces several evolving threats:
Quantum Computing
Shor’s algorithm could break current public key cryptography, prompting development of post-quantum algorithms like lattice-based cryptography that resist quantum attacks.
Side-Channel Attacks
Sophisticated attackers can extract keys by analyzing power consumption or electromagnetic emissions during cryptographic operations, requiring hardware countermeasures.
Protecting Your Digital Presence
Users should enable full-disk encryption on devices, use password managers to generate strong unique passwords, and verify websites use HTTPS with modern cipher suites. Understanding encryption helps make informed decisions about digital security in an increasingly connected world.